老 Q如何在没有 root 权限的情况下设置 OpenVPN 服务器?
有没有办法在没有 root 权限的情况下设置 OpenVPN 服务器?例如在我的主目录中有配置文件?如果是,我该如何设置?
我正在尝试通过 SSH 进入系统并在那里设置 OpenVPN 服务器供个人使用。
编辑
由于很明显 OpenVPN 需要 root 权限,我将问题更改为使用可以轻松设置的 SSH 路由我的互联网。
我有 Ubuntu 12.04 LTS,我尝试升级到 Ubuntu 12.10。当我单击更新管理器升级时,出现了一个消息框:
无法运行升级。这通常是由 /tmp 挂载为 noexec 的系统引起的。请在没有 noexec 的情况下重新挂载并再次运行升级。
我尝试使用以下命令在终端中使 /tmp 可执行:
mount -o remount,exec /tmp /var/tmp
Run Code Online (Sandbox Code Playgroud)
我按 Enter 并从终端收到以下消息:
mount: only root can do that
Run Code Online (Sandbox Code Playgroud)
我现在应该怎么做才能使 /tmp 可执行并升级操作系统。
我正在使用提升。我使用sudo apt-get install
. 现在我无法在我的文件系统上找到我的 boost lib 文件。
我想在我的 Qt 项目中包含 lib 的路径。grepping 花费的时间太长了 :( 我在 中找到了包含/usr/include/boost
。但我还需要知道库路径。
您好,我升级了 Ubuntu 上的所有软件包,也升级了内核。但是在升级过程中内核升级失败,我必须在grub加载后总是选择旧内核。这是重新安装最新内核的终端命令吗?
我已经安装了最新版本的OSSEC (2.8.1) 并且我还启用了电子邮件通知。我收到了大量此类通知,说存在硬件错误和有关 mce 的一些信息:
OSSEC HIDS Notification.
2015 Apr 04 20:09:22
Received From: Bath-Towel->/var/log/syslog
Rule: 1002 fired (level 2) -> "Unknown problem somewhere in the system."
Portion of the log(s):
Apr 4 20:09:21 Bath-Towel kernel: [ 1873.680872] mce: [Hardware Error]: Machine check events logged
--END OF NOTIFICATION
Run Code Online (Sandbox Code Playgroud)
那么这到底是什么意思呢?mce 代表什么?这个明显的硬件错误是我应该担心的吗?
操作系统信息:
Description: Ubuntu 14.10
Release: 14.10
Run Code Online (Sandbox Code Playgroud) 我使用的是 Ubuntu 12.04.2 LTS,64 位,OpenVPN 客户端 2.3.1
如何防止 OpenVPN 在启动或重启时自动启动?
根据情况,我使用扬声器或耳机进行音频输出。鉴于我的耳机是 USB 耳机,它的行为就像它自己的音频设备。
目前,我通过单击右上角托盘中的扬声器图标在音频输出设备之间切换,在那里我选择声音设置,转到输出选项卡,然后选择我想要的设备。
我想知道是否有一些更简单/更快的方法来回切换到我的 USB 耳机?也许是专用托盘图标、键映射等?
我正在使用默认的 Gnome 桌面运行 Ubuntu 10.04。
我无法在 LibreOffice Draw 上绘制任何有用的东西。制作图表的不同形状在哪里?我所能找到的只是我可以在 Microsoft Word 上找到的基本形状(正方形、圆形、星形、箭头等)。我能否制作更精细的图表,如数据流图或基本的 UML 图?
我想用来ffmpeg
在我的 Ubuntu 11.10 上存储我的 USB 网络摄像头拍摄的图像。lsusb
输出:
Bus 002 Device 003: ID 0c45:6028 Microdia Typhoon Easycam USB 330K (older)
Run Code Online (Sandbox Code Playgroud)
相机使用奶酪工作正常,但我想使用命令行工具使其可编写脚本,但如果我尝试:
ffmpeg -i /dev/v4l/by-id/usb-0c45_USB_camera-video-index0 image.jpg
Run Code Online (Sandbox Code Playgroud)
输出是:
user@box:~$ sudo ffmpeg -i /dev/v4l/by-id/usb-0c45_USB_camera-video-index0 image.jpg
[sudo] password for user:
ffmpeg version 0.7.3-4:0.7.3-0ubuntu0.11.10.1, Copyright (c) 2000-2011 the Libav developers
built on Jan 4 2012 16:21:50 with gcc 4.6.1
configuration: --extra-version='4:0.7.3-0ubuntu0.11.10.1' --arch=i386 --prefix=/usr --enable-vdpau --enable-bzlib --enable-libgsm --enable-libschroedinger --enable-libspeex --enable-libtheora --enable-libvorbis --enable-pthreads --enable-zlib --enable-libvpx --enable-runtime-cpudetect --enable-vaapi --enable-gpl --enable-postproc --enable-swscale --enable-x11grab --enable-libdc1394 --enable-shared --disable-static
WARNING: …
Run Code Online (Sandbox Code Playgroud) 我正在尝试删除我删除/etc/init.d/disco-master
文件的包(试图手动删除包)。我想删除disco-master
包裹。我现在该怎么做?
当我这样做时会发生这种情况sudo apt-get remove disco-master
:
removing disco-master ...
invoke-rc.d: unknown initscript, /etc/init.d/disco-master not found.
dpkg: error processing disco-master (--remove):
subprocess installed pre-removal script returned error exit status 100
Errors were encountered while processing:
disco-master
E: Sub-process /usr/bin/dpkg returned an error code (1)
Run Code Online (Sandbox Code Playgroud)
当我这样做时,sudo apt-get install --reinstall disco-master
我得到以下信息:
You might want to run 'apt-get -f install' to correct these:
The following packages have unmet dependencies:
disco-master : Depends: disco-node (= 0.4.2+nmu1) but it …
Run Code Online (Sandbox Code Playgroud)